Maybe have some way of turning off the f= lock=20 +> requirement? Some daemons, even if they don't use pidfile(3), they do use flock(2) to lo= ck the pidfile (eg. cron(8)). I added this option to pkill(1) in the past, but I wasn't very happy with it until today... On the other hand, I added it to avoid: kill `cat /var/run/daemon.pid`... Hmm, what do you think about reverting '-F' behaviour and make it use flock(2) only when '-L' is also given? --=20 Pawel Jakub Dawidek http://www.wheel.pl pjd@FreeBSD.org http://www.FreeBSD.org FreeBSD committer Am I Evil?
